NHTSA Recall 12V431000

Filed by Ford Motor Company. Component: Engine And Engine Cooling. Reported 2012-09-04. An estimated 6,146 vehicles are affected. Recall repairs are free at any authorized dealer.

Defect

Ford is recalling certain model year 2013 Escape vehicles manufactured from October 5, 2011, through August 31, 2012, equipped with 1.6L engines. The cylinder head cup plug (freeze plug) may become dislodged resulting in significant loss of engine coolant.

Risk

As leaking engine coolant evaporates on the hot engine, the glycol may ignite causing an engine compartment fire.

What the manufacturer will do

Ford will notify owners, and dealers will seal the existing plug and add a secondary plug cover, free of charge. The safety recall began on September 11, 2012. Owners may contact Ford at 1-866-436-7332.
